1. Copper (C11000 Alloy)
Key Properties:
Copper sheets made from C11000 alloy are known for their excellent electrical conductivity (approximately 97% IACS), thermal conductivity, and corrosion resistance. They can withstand high temperatures, making them suitable for applications involving heat transfer.
Pros & Cons:
The primary advantage of copper is its superior conductivity, which is critical in electrical applications. Additionally, its natural resistance to corrosion makes it ideal for plumbing and roofing. However, copper can be more expensive than alternative materials and may require protective coatings in harsh environments to prevent tarnishing.
Impact on Application:
Copper is highly compatible with various media, including water, air, and certain chemicals. Its high thermal conductivity makes it a preferred choice for heat exchangers and electrical components.
Considerations for International Buyers:
Buyers should ensure compliance with ASTM standards, particularly ASTM B152 for copper sheets. Additionally, the fluctuating price of copper can impact budgeting, necessitating careful planning.

In-depth Look: Manufacturing Processes and Quality Assurance for 18 gauge copper sheet
Manufacturing Processes for 18 Gauge Copper Sheet
The production of 18 gauge copper sheets involves several critical stages that ensure the material meets specific industry standards and customer requirements. Understanding these stages helps international B2B buyers assess potential suppliers and the quality of the products they offer.
Material Preparation
The manufacturing process begins with selecting high-grade copper, typically Alloy C110 (Electrolytic Tough Pitch Copper). The quality of the raw material is paramount, as it affects both the mechanical properties and conductivity of the final product.
- Melting and Casting: Copper is melted in a furnace and cast into large slabs or billets. The purity of the copper is verified through chemical analysis at this stage.
- Rolling: The cast copper is then hot-rolled to reduce its thickness. This process helps achieve the desired gauge, in this case, 18 gauge, which is approximately 0.0478 inches (1.214 mm) thick.
Forming
After rolling, the copper sheets undergo further processing to meet the required specifications.
- Cold Rolling: This technique is employed to refine the thickness and improve surface finish. Cold rolling also enhances the mechanical properties of the copper by increasing its strength through work hardening.
- Annealing: The sheets are subjected to an annealing process to relieve internal stresses and improve ductility. This step is crucial for applications requiring bending or forming.
- Trimming and Cutting: The sheets are trimmed to the desired dimensions. Precision cutting techniques such as laser cutting or water jet cutting are often used to ensure accuracy.
Finishing
The finishing stage adds the final touches to the copper sheets, enhancing their aesthetic and functional qualities.
- Surface Treatments: Depending on the end-use, the copper sheets may undergo various surface treatments. Options include polishing, coating, or patination to improve corrosion resistance and aesthetic appeal.
- Quality Inspection: Before packaging, the sheets are subjected to rigorous quality checks to ensure they meet specified tolerances and surface quality.
Quality Assurance in Manufacturing
Quality assurance is an integral part of the manufacturing process for 18 gauge copper sheets. Adhering to international standards ensures that the products meet customer expectations and regulatory requirements.
Relevant International Standards
- ISO 9001: This standard outlines the requirements for a quality management system, ensuring consistent quality in manufacturing processes.
- ASTM Standards: The American Society for Testing and Materials (ASTM) provides specifications for the chemical composition, mechanical properties, and testing methods for copper products.
- CE Marking: For products sold in Europe, CE marking signifies compliance with EU safety, health, and environmental protection standards.
Quality Control Checkpoints
Quality control (QC) is typically structured around several checkpoints throughout the manufacturing process:
- Incoming Quality Control (IQC): Raw materials are inspected upon receipt to verify their quality and compliance with specifications.
- In-Process Quality Control (IPQC): During the manufacturing process, periodic checks are conducted to ensure each stage meets quality standards.
- Final Quality Control (FQC): The finished copper sheets undergo a final inspection before packaging and shipping. This includes dimensional checks and visual inspections for surface defects.
Common Testing Methods
To ensure the quality and performance of 18 gauge copper sheets, several testing methods are employed:
- Mechanical Testing: Tensile strength, yield strength, and elongation tests are performed to assess the material’s mechanical properties.
- Chemical Analysis: Spectroscopic methods are used to verify the chemical composition of the copper, ensuring it meets specified standards.
- Non-Destructive Testing (NDT): Techniques such as ultrasonic testing and eddy current testing are utilized to detect internal defects without damaging the material.

Essential Technical Properties and Trade Terminology for 18 gauge copper sheet
Understanding the technical properties and trade terminology associated with 18 gauge copper sheet is essential for B2B buyers, especially those from diverse markets like Africa, South America, the Middle East, and Europe. This section outlines the key specifications and industry jargon that will aid in making informed purchasing decisions.
Key Technical Properties of 18 Gauge Copper Sheet
-
Material Grade
18 gauge copper sheet is typically made from C11000 (Electrolytic Tough Pitch Copper), which is known for its excellent electrical conductivity (around 97% IACS) and corrosion resistance. Understanding the material grade helps buyers assess suitability for specific applications, such as electrical components or architectural designs. -
Thickness
The standard thickness for 18 gauge copper sheet is 0.0478 inches (1.214 mm). This thickness strikes a balance between flexibility and strength, making it ideal for various applications ranging from roofing to decorative arts. Buyers must consider thickness to ensure compatibility with fabrication methods and end-use requirements. -
Tolerance
Copper sheets typically come with a thickness tolerance of ±0.002 inches (±0.0508 mm). This specification is crucial for projects requiring precision, as even minor deviations can affect the performance and aesthetics of the final product. Tolerance impacts fabrication processes such as bending, punching, and welding. -
Weight
An 18 gauge copper sheet weighs approximately 1.968 pounds per square foot (9.6 kg/m²). Knowing the weight helps buyers calculate shipping costs and determine the structural capacity of applications, particularly in construction and manufacturing sectors. -
Surface Finish
The surface finish of copper sheets can vary from mill finish to polished or coated options. The finish affects not only the aesthetic appeal but also the material’s corrosion resistance and adherence to coatings. Buyers should evaluate the finish based on the intended application, whether for decorative purposes or industrial use. -
Formability
18 gauge copper is known for its excellent formability, allowing for processes such as bending, stamping, and deep drawing. This property is critical for manufacturers looking to create complex shapes without compromising the integrity of the material. Understanding formability aids in selecting the right gauge for specific fabrication needs.
Common Trade Terms in B2B Copper Sheet Transactions
-
OEM (Original Equipment Manufacturer)
This term refers to a company that produces parts or equipment that may be marketed by another manufacturer. In the copper sheet industry, OEMs often specify the gauge and material grade required for components in various applications, influencing purchasing decisions. -
MOQ (Minimum Order Quantity)
MOQ is the smallest quantity of a product that a supplier is willing to sell. For copper sheets, understanding MOQ is essential for buyers to manage inventory levels and budget constraints, particularly for smaller businesses or projects. -
RFQ (Request for Quotation)
An RFQ is a document sent to suppliers requesting pricing and terms for a specific quantity of goods. This process helps buyers compare prices and negotiate better deals on 18 gauge copper sheets, ensuring they receive competitive offers. -
Incoterms (International Commercial Terms)
These are predefined commercial terms published by the International Chamber of Commerce (ICC) that clarify the responsibilities of buyers and sellers in international trade. Familiarity with Incoterms, such as FOB (Free on Board) or CIF (Cost, Insurance, and Freight), is crucial for B2B buyers to understand shipping costs and risk management in cross-border transactions. -
Lead Time
This term refers to the time taken from placing an order to delivery. In the context of 18 gauge copper sheets, lead time can vary based on factors such as production schedules and shipping logistics. Buyers should inquire about lead times to plan their projects effectively. -
Certification
Certification indicates that the copper sheet meets specific industry standards, such as ASTM or ISO. Certifications provide assurance regarding the quality and performance of the material, which is particularly important for industries that require compliance with regulatory standards.
